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13442398 56 710806 74
9353 934616 066
9353 934616 066
4970159208 174 44966 343 89876278
All about undefined
Interested in learning more?
9353 934616 066
4970159208 174 44966 343 89876278
See more
5010159 613531185
36553 220 185974740
See more
64494392224 9327
060709 74551521020 0487 49319
See more